Some entrepreneurial New York Red Bulls supporters are aiming to capitalize on their teamā€™s 7-0 thrashing of rival New York City FC, putting a pair of T-shirts commemorating the mauling up for sale in the aftermath of Saturdayā€™s match.


Naturally, both shirts are red with white lettering. One of the tees offers up a play on the US menā€™s national teamā€™s iconic ā€œDos A Ceroā€ wins over Mexico, reading ā€œSiete A Ceroā€ with the date of the match ā€“ May 21, 2016 ā€“ emblazoned below the main text. The other shirt is a riff on the 7Up logo, with stylized ā€œ7-Nilā€ text plastered across the front of the shirt.

Of course, Red Bulls fans have done a bit more than make a couple of T-shirts since their club roasted their Hudson River rivals on Saturday. A flurry of fans have put together videos highlighting the Red Bullsā€™ seven goals. One of our favorites, from YouTube user adiamas, is below:



NYCFC will host the Red Bulls again on July 3. The two sides will meet for the third and final time this regular season on July 24 at Red Bull Arena.
